The regular chewing scrapes plaque from their teeth. Make sure you rotate and watch Harmless chew toys. Also, be mindful that chew toys will likely not crack teeth - sure types of bones can fracture your Canine's teeth.
You should definitely use toothpaste formulated especially for dogs; human toothpaste normally contains ingredients like xylitol, that is toxic to dogs. Hard chew toys may also be a choice In regards to dental hygiene and a fantastic choice for canines that don't tolerate brushing.

Overgrowth on the gums is just not prevalent and should actually have a genetic result in, Though some medicines can cause it. It’s known as gingival hyperplasia, and it’s most commonly found in Boxers, Bulldogs, and Cocker Spaniels.
Examining in on your Pet’s gums and teeth each individual couple of weeks will let you understand what’s happening inside their mouth. Their gums need to be pink. If they are white, red, or swollen, you might like to agenda a stop by for the vet. Their teeth must be clear without the need of brown tartar buildup.
Periodontal disease is the commonest ailment in puppies more than three several years of age. In canines, as in humans, each day tooth brushing, as a way of active dental household care, is taken into account the gold common for prophylaxis and prevention of periodontal sickness progression. However, the performance of enough tooth brushing is insufficient in canine.
